On April 8, 2025, migrant worker advocacy groups held a peaceful protest at a machine accessories manufacturer in Gyeongsan, South Korea, demanding compensation for injured migrant workers affected by government crackdowns on undocumented workers. The event appears limited in scope and severity.
Supply chain impact
No commodities or chokepoints are directly mapped to this event. Second-order effects would depend on whether labor disputes at manufacturing facilities escalate or spread to other industrial areas, but the peaceful nature and advocacy focus suggest minimal immediate disruption risk.
